Alpine tour through the Sella Group

The via ferrata Setus takes us from Passo Gardena to the Pisciadù lake, the Boè hut and to the Passo Pordoi

The 3,152-m high Sella Group in the heart of the Dolomites is also known for being "the mountain of the Ladins". From Passo Gardena at 2,121 m a.s.l. we take path no. 666 towards southeast where the Val Setus, an avalanche chute, ascends between the rock walls of the Sella Group. The upper part of the route through the Val Setus is a secured but very steep and difficult via ferrata leading to the managed Pisciadù hut at 2,587 m a.s.l. We pass Lake Pisciadù and ascend along path no. 666 southwards through the Val Tita.

The iron footholds help us to tackle the rocks before the flat mountain ridge at 2,960 m a.s.l. A hilly section takes us to the Antersass and after 4 hours of walking we arrive at the managed Boè hut at 2,873 m a.s.l., one of the highest mountain huts in the Dolomites.

The rocks of the Sella Group below the Piz Boè enclose the Val Lasties like a ring. Path no. 627 leading to the Pordoi Pass (Maria hut) and to the Sasso Pordoi runs across this area. On the Sass Pordoi at 2,950 m a.s.l. lies the mountain station of the cable car taking us back to the Passo Pordoi at 2,240 m a.s.l. We return to the Passo Gardena, our starting point, by bus.

Note: this tour across the landscapes of the Sella Group at almost 3,000 m a.s.l. can be made only by experienced and sure-footed hikers. Undertake this hike only in case of good weather and check the timetables of the bus from Passo Pordoi to the Val Gardena beforehand.

difficulty: difficult summit route with lifts ferrata / fixed rope route
  • Starting point:
    Passo Gardena
  • Overall time:
    04:45 h
  • Total route length:
    12,1 km
  • Altitude:
    from 2.136 m to 2.981 m
  • Altitude difference (uphill | downhill):
    +1223 m | -386 m
  • Route:
    Passo Gardena - Setus Via Ferrata - Pisciadù mountain hut - Lake Pisciadù - Val Tita - Antersass - Boè mountain hut - Pordoi wind gap - Mt Sass Pordoi - Passo Pordoi
  • Signposts:
    666, Alta Via of the Dolomites AV2, 627
  • Destination:
    Sass Pordoi
  • Resting points:
    Rifugio Pisciadù mountain hut, Rifugio Boè mountain hut, Rifugio Forcella Pordoi mountain hut, Rifugio Maria mountain hut
